Common signs to watch

  • Wall sections that lean or shift out of line
  • Cracks that keep widening over time
  • Loose blocks, stone movement, or separated joints
  • Soil pressure building behind the wall
  • Drainage that appears to be pooling near the structure

Repair or replace

Not every wall needs to be removed and rebuilt. Some walls only need targeted repair, while others have reached a point where replacement is the smarter long-term choice. We help homeowners sort through that decision with a practical evaluation of the visible damage and the structure behind it.

When repair may fit

Repair can make sense when the wall is otherwise sound but has specific problem areas, such as separated sections, minor movement, or damage that has not spread across the full structure. In those cases, addressing the weak point can extend the life of the wall and improve how it performs.

When replacement may fit

Replacement is often the better path when the wall is widely shifted, heavily cracked, or no longer performing the way it should. A new build gives us the chance to correct layout issues, improve support, and plan for better drainage from the start.

Why drainage matters

A retaining wall has to manage more than visible weight. Water movement behind the wall can add pressure and reduce performance if it is not accounted for during design and construction. That is why drainage planning is part of the work we consider on every retaining wall project.

Good drainage support helps reduce the chance of movement, helps protect the wall structure, and supports long-term durability. It is especially important on hillside retaining walls and on any wall that holds back a significant amount of soil.
